Veedol Oil When You Say Pennsylvania Ad 1939 This is a July 1, 1939 advertisement. It is a nice color ad from Tide Water Oil Company, makers of Veedol Motor Oil with nice graphics from an early magazine. It says when you say Pennsylvania a Student thinks of Independence Hall and a careful motorist thinks of Veedol There is a nice color picture of Independence Hall and there is a signature of Mary Parley (not sure of the spelling). In mint condition. Photo is taken through plastic and may show wrinkles or crookedness that is not in the ad. This magazine tear sheet measures 10" wide by 14" tall.
